Wiktionary
TARZAN, proper noun. A heroic fictional character, raised in the jungle by apes.
TARZAN, noun. (by extension) A strong man.
Dictionary definition
TARZAN, noun. (sometimes used ironically) a man of great strength and agility (after the hero of a series of novels by Edgar Rice Burroughs).
TARZAN, noun. A man raised by apes who was the hero of a series of novels by Edgar Rice Burroughs.
